Code · California · Welfare and Institutions Code

§ 14094.17

(a)A Medi-Cal managed care plan participating in the Whole Child Model program shall create and maintain a clinical advisory committee, composed of the managed care contractor’s chief medical officer or the equivalent, the county CCS medical director, and at least four CCS-paneled providers, to advise on clinical issues relating to CCS conditions, including treatment authorization guidelines, and serve as clinical advisers on other clinical issues relating to CCS conditions.
(1)A Medi-Cal managed care plan participating in the Whole Child Model program shall establish a family advisory group for CCS families.
(2)Family representatives who serve on this advisory group may receive a reasonable per diem payment to enable in-person participation in the advisory group. A plan may conduct family advisory group meetings by teleconference or through other similar electronic means to facilitate family participation in this advisory group.
(3)A representative of this local group shall be invited to serve on the department’s statewide stakeholder advisory group established pursuant to subdivision (c).
(1)The department shall establish a statewide Whole Child Model program stakeholder advisory group, or modify an existing Whole Child Model program stakeholder advisory group, composed of representatives of CCS providers, county CCS program administrators, health plans, family resource centers, regional centers, recognized exclusive representatives of CCS county providers, CCS case managers, CCS medical therapy units, and representatives from family advisory groups established pursuant to subdivision (b). Participation on the statewide stakeholder advisory group shall be voluntary, and members shall be ineligible for travel or other per diem payments.
(2)The department shall consult with the stakeholder advisory group on the implementation of the Whole Child Model program and shall consider the recommendations of the stakeholder advisory group in developing the monitoring processes and outcome measures by which the plans participating in the Whole Child Model program shall be monitored and evaluated.
(3)The statewide Whole Child Model program stakeholder advisory group, as established under this section, shall terminate on December 31, 2026.
